Results:
The addition of NS improved cell viability in a concentration-dependent manner, with Group B showing the highest viability. Both NS groups demonstrated reduced initial and final setting times compared to MTA alone. Mineralization was significantly enhanced in NS groups, particularly in Group B.
Conclusion:
Incorporation of NS, especially at 50%, enhances the biocompatibility, accelerates the setting time, and improves the mineralization potential of MTA, suggesting its potential as a beneficial modification for endodontic applications.
